Legendary Quarterbacks of the Past

Many of the Rams’ most iconic quarterbacks played during the franchise’s earlier years. These players set the foundation for the team’s success and are remembered for their exceptional skills and leadership.

  • Roman Gabriel – Played for the Rams from 1962 to 1972, Gabriel was known for his strong arm and leadership. He was a four-time Pro Bowler and led the team to multiple playoff appearances.
  • Kurt Warner – Although he is often associated with the St. Louis Rams, Warner’s time with the franchise was transformative. His 1999 season culminated in a Super Bowl victory and earned him the MVP title.
  • Marc Bulger – Served as the Rams’ starting quarterback from 2003 to 2009, Bulger was known for his accuracy and ability to lead the offense during the early 2000s.

Modern Era and Recent Stars

The recent history of the Rams features quarterbacks who have made significant impacts on the team’s performance and reputation. Their talents have helped shape the franchise’s modern identity.

  • Jared Goff – The first overall pick in 2016, Goff led the Rams to a Super Bowl appearance in 2019 and set multiple franchise records during his tenure.
  • Matthew Stafford – Acquired in 2021, Stafford brought veteran leadership and a strong arm, culminating in a Super Bowl victory in 2022.
  • Sam Bradford – The first overall pick in 2010, Bradford was known for his accuracy and mobility, setting several rookie records.
